WikiLeaks founder says big leak on Hillary Clinton could lead to indictment

WikiLeaks founder, Julian Assange, says this year he is going to leak information on Hillary Clinton that could be extremely damaging to the presumptive Democratic nominee. Speaking to a British TV station, Assange said, "We've accumulated a lot of material about Hillary Clinton. We could proceed to an indictment."
Assange went on to say he doesn't think Clinton will actually face charges because he doesn't believe the current Attorney General, Loretta Lynch, will indict her, but he thinks the FBI will use the information to push for concessions from the Clinton administration, should she be elected. While Assange did say Clinton poses a problem for freedom of the press, he stopped short of saying he would prefer to see a Trump Presidency.
